Which of the following statements about exponential growth curves is true?
nevsk [136]

Answer:

a. Exponential growth curves are common for R-selected species.

Explanation

Exponential growth looks like J shaped curve which is representative of R-selected species. R-selected species have tons of offspring with short life expectancy (or in unstable conditions) such as mice, rabbits etc.
